1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the definition of a linear function?

Back

A linear function is a function that can be graphically represented in the Cartesian plane as a straight line. It has the form y = mx + b, where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does the slope of a line represent?

Back

The slope of a line represents the rate of change of the y-coordinate with respect to the x-coordinate. It indicates how steep the line is and the direction it goes (positive or negative).

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the y-intercept of a linear function?

Back

The y-intercept is the point where the line crosses the y-axis. It is represented by the value of b in the equation y = mx + b.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How can you identify the y-intercept from the equation y = 3x + 5?

Back

The y-intercept is 5, which means the line crosses the y-axis at the point (0, 5).

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the significance of the x-intercept in a linear function?

Back

The x-intercept is the point where the line crosses the x-axis. It can be found by setting y = 0 in the equation of the line.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you find the x-intercept of the equation y = 2x - 6?

Back

Set y = 0: 0 = 2x - 6. Solving gives x = 3, so the x-intercept is (3, 0).
